THE TEAM NEWS
SYDNEY SIXERS
Coach: Greg Shipperd
Captain: Moises Henriques
- After two defeats in a row, the Sixers bounced back in emphatic style by hammering Brisbane Heat on Sunday by 79 runs as they defended their total of 177/7 by bowling out the Heat for just 98 in 18.1 overs.
- James Vince enjoyed the best innings since signing for the Sixers with a classy 75 from 46 balls and their batting line-up continues to be strong and solid with virtually all of their top six contributing consistently this season.
- The performance of Lloyd Pope on his debut against Heat was another bright spot for them as he impressed with his two wickets and as they have named an unchanged squad for this match, they could repeat the same eleven too.
HOBART HURRICANES
Coach: Adam Griffith
Captain: Matthew Wade
- It has been a stunning start to the Big Bash for Hobart Hurricanes having won eight of their opening nine matches and they come off arguably their best performance of the entire tournament as they restricted the Strikers to just 154 and then smashed through the total without losing a wicket.
- Matthew Wade and D’Arcy Short produced an outstanding opening partnership of 158 – the highest in the tournament so far – and they continued their superb form as they completely outplayed the Strikers and extended their lead at the top of the ladder.
- Continuity has been a big positive for them and they are afforded the luxury of naming an unchanged squad of 13 yet again as they have not been impacted by international call-ups at all.
